McGovern: Daschle Will Seek White House
NewsMax.com ^ | 7/3/02

Posted on 07/03/2002 2:11:05 PM PDT by GeneD

Former South Dakota Sen. George McGovern, who lost his own race for the White House to Richard Nixon in the biggest landslide in American history, predicted Tuesday night that fellow South Dakotan, Senate plurality leader Tom Daschle, will eventually run for president.

"My guess is that at some point he'll run," McGovern told WABC Radio's John Batchelor and Paul Alexander. "Whether he'll do it in 2004, though, I think, is another question."

If the Democrats retain their plurality in the Senate after this year's midterm election, Daschle will likely stay put, the 1972 Democratic presidential candidate said.

"He likes the job that he now has," added McGovern," so he'll have to decide that."
